Marius Hammer (Bergen, 1847-1927)
Japanese influenced silver, ginbari cloisonné and enamel three-piece tea service, c. 1910-1915, comprising a stylised teapot, cream and sugar, embellished with entwined sinuous ribbon white enamel decoration on a rich green cloisonné ground, with silver banding throughout, stamped to the underside 'M. Hammer', '930S', with monogram, teapot 11.5cm high, 1,239g gross.
This tea set was probably designed by Emil Hoye (Denmark) who was Hammer's artistic director from 1910-16, Hoye was influenced by fellow Danish designer Georg Jensen.
